Given the challenges of managing AI, what avenues might we see for the development of an international regime to manage national intervention in the AI sector?

​The seminar is organised by SKEMA Center for Artificial Intelligence (SCAI).

​​The rise of new economic statecr​aft with intervention by governments to regulate investment and trade behind the border, at the border, and beyond the border continues to create tension in the global economy across a host of sectors. In particular, national governments are increasingly focused on the regulation of artificial intelligence.  

For its part, the EU has also taken a leadership role in developing AI regulation, despite being behind the U.S and China in terms of development of the industry.
